Cognitive Bias and the Web: Exploring the Psychology Behind W3 Information Processing
The World Wide Web offers a vast array of information, constantly surrounding users with data. This colossal influx of content can significantly influence how we absorb data, often leading to cognitive read more biases. These strategies forged by our brains frequently alter our view of the online realm.
- For example, confirmation bias may lead to users solely seeking out information that supports their existing opinions.
- Similarly, the availability heuristic guides our decisions based on how easily we can access information. This frequently produce inflating the likelihood of events that are vividly remembered.
Understanding these cognitive biases is crucial for navigating the web efficiently. By being aware our own biases, we can reduce their effect on our decisions and make more rational judgments.
